Eau Lovely is a collection built to encourage people to live their happiest, most positive life possible. Designed by Rachel McCann in Dublin, the Eau Lovely collection consists of a selection of heart-warming, beautifully fragrant candles and reed diffusers. 

 

An ambassador for positivity, Rachel has a passion for all things fragrance, from essential oils through to beautiful perfume. A trained perfumist having learned her craft in Paris, Rachel’s passion for scents encouraged her to create Eau Lovely. 

 

Presented in a beautiful glass container, we just adore the Eau So Amazing Candle. Made from natural soy wax, this candle also includes Tiger Eye stones set into the wax.
